Beaudiment, Julien

Julien Beaudiment is a French flutist who studied flute with Paul Edmund-Davies and Averill Williams at the Guildhall School of Music in London, and Sophie Cherrier at the Conservatoire National Supérieur de Musique de Paris.
He has been principal flute with the Los Angeles Philharmonic, BBC National Orchestra of Wales, and Orchestre de l'Opéra National de Lyon. Julien Beaudiment is a dedicated chamber musician and Laureate of the Barcelona international sonata competition.  He is a member of the “Faust wind quintet”.
Julien Beaudiment currently teaches at the Conservatoire National Supérieur de Musique de Lyon and is an artistic deputy at the Haute Ecole de Musique de Lausanne in Switzerland. Additionally he gives lessons at several academies: "Vanderbilt Academy” in Aix en Provence, the "Nice International summer Academy", the "Bruges Academy" in Belgium, the "Academie Internationale des Arcs" and gives masterclasses in USA, Europe and Asia.
